Preserving artificial chlorinated pools calls for common monitoring of chlorine levels and water high-quality. Pool operators and homeowners will have to Check out the chlorine focus frequently to make certain it stays within the encouraged variety. Also minor chlorine may result in insufficient sanitation, allowing for germs and algae to prosper. Conversely, extreme chlorine degrees could potentially cause pores and skin and eye irritation for swimmers. The perfect chlorine stage for artificial chlorinated swimming pools generally falls amongst one and three sections for each million (ppm). Sustaining this balance is essential for providing a snug and Protected swimming experience.

In addition to chlorine stages, synthetic chlorinated pools have to have proper pH equilibrium. The pH of pool h2o ought to Preferably be amongst seven.2 and 7.6. Should the pH is too low, the water turns into acidic, resulting in corrosion of pool products and distress for swimmers. In the event the pH is just too substantial, chlorine results in being fewer powerful, cutting down its capacity to sanitize the h2o. Normal testing and adjustment of pH ranges enable be sure that artificial chlorinated pools continue to be effectively-well balanced and cozy for consumers. Pool owners typically use pH testing kits and chemical adjustments to keep up the proper pH concentrations in their pools.

One more essential element of synthetic chlorinated swimming pools is the usage of st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ade promptly when subjected to sunlight, cutting down its success like a disinfectant. To overcome this, pool owners typically increase c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that can help lengthen the life of chlorine in outside swimming pools. Without stabilizers, chlorine levels can drop quickly, requiring frequent additions to maintain good sanitation. By utilizing the suitable degree of stabilizer, synthetic chlorinated pools can stay cleaner for extended periods with minimal chlorine decline.

Artificial chlorinated swimming pools also demand routine routine maintenance outside of chemical balancing. Filtration programs Participate in a vital job in preserving the water cleanse by eliminating debris, Filth, and natural and organic issue. Pool filters, including s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, enable entice impurities and forestall them from circulating while in the drinking water. Regular cleaning and backwashing of filters be certain they function competently. Furthermore, pool house owners should really skim the drinking water area, vacuum the pool flooring, and brush the pool walls to forestall algae buildup and retain water clarity. Right servicing aids artificial chlorinated swimming pools stay in ideal problem for swimmers.

Despite the numerous advantages of synthetic chlorinated swimming pools, it is crucial for pool entrepreneurs and operators to follow safety guidelines and most effective tactics. Good storage and dealing with of chlorine and also other pool chemical substances are essential to prevent mishaps and chemical imbalances. Chlorine needs to be saved within a cool, dry position far from immediate daylight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other chemicals, which include ammonia or acids, can generate perilous reactions. Pool upkeep personnel need to be skilled in chemical basic safety and follow advised rules for managing and software.
